Transaction 94d757ed9bf7466196e67e36351fd73d16f8328d3d5a99fa1081258e2362b998
1 Input
1 Output
-
94d757ed9bf7466196e67e36351fd73d16f8328d3d5a99fa1081258e2362b998:0
- value
- 326760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c868c28b54cdb26922dfde956c327f5e0c8ea9e OP_EQUAL
- address
- 34Hr2SQp2828YGVj3vggyv8Pd52SVjjCT3